How Our Tile Floor Water Damage Restoration Process Works

We take a straightforward approach to tile floor water damage restoration, focusing on getting the job done right the first time. Here’s what you can expect:

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our team arrives on-site to assess the damage and create a plan for restoration. This step typically takes 1-2 hours, depending on the size of the affected area. We’ll take photos and document the damage to help with insurance claims.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Using specialized equipment, our technicians extract as much water as possible from the affected area, reducing the risk of mold growth. This step usually takes around 2-4 hours, depending on the amount of water present.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We use industrial-strength fans and dehumidifiers to dry the area completely, ensuring that the water damage is fully mitigated. This step typically takes 24-48 hours, depending on the humidity levels in the area.

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ting

Our team thoroughly cleans and disinfects the affected area to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ria. This step usually takes around 2-4 hours, depending on the level of contamination.

Step 5: Repairs and Rebuilding

Once the area is dry and clean, we begin repairs and rebuilding to ensure your property is restored to its original condition. This step can take anywhere from a few days to several weeks, depending on the extent of the damage.

Warning Signs You Need Tile Floor Water Damage Restoration

Catching water damage early can save you a small fortune and prevent bigger problems down the line. Keep an eye out for these warning signs: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ant odors can be a sign of mold growth or water damage.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it’s time to call our team for an assessment.

Warped or Discolored Flooring

Water damage can cause wooden or tile flooring to warp or discolor. If you notice any changes in the appearance of your flooring, it’s essential to have it inspected by a professional.

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

Water stains on ceilings or walls can be a sign of a more significant issue. Our team will assess the damage and provide a plan for restoration.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or high humidity. If you notice any changes in the appearance of your walls or ceilings, it’s time to call us for an assessment.

Visible Water Damage or Leaks

Visible water damage or leaks can be a sign of a more significant issue. Our team will assess the damage and provide a plan for restoration.

Tile Floor Water Damage Restoration Cost in Cold Spring, KY

The cost of tile floor water damage restoration varies depending on the size of the affected area, the severity of the damage, and local conditions in Cold Spring, KY. Here’s a rough estimate of what you might expect: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Planning $100 – $500 Size of affected area, complexity of damage
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Amount of water present, specialized equ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Humidity levels, size of affected area
Cleaning and Disinfecting $200 – $1,000 Level of contamination, specialized cleaning supplies
Repairs and Rebuilding $2,000 – $10,000 Scope of repairs, materials needed

Keep in mind that these estimates are rough and may vary depending on the specifics of your situation. Our team will provide a more accurate quote after assessing the damage on-site.
